    Actually, it is clear they are not. Wild swings of +37% one patch to -63% next patch is proof they are not. Judge by actions not by words. The actions since U22 have shown that they haven't:

    1.) Have any baseline plan whatsoever. That became even more apparent on the stream yesterday with the "we thought it would be cool if this did that" or "we felt it would be neat if".

    2.) They are not, at all, trying to balance. How can you seriously say they are when in one patch they increase the damage of a skill (Twin Slashes) 37% because it was under-performing, to then cut it back 63% in the next patch to be under performing?

    Simple math (using 250 initial and 1,250 DoT damage as a base for example). In U22 it did 1,500 damage total. In U23 they say the skill has been under- performing so they increase the DoT damage 37% to bring the total to 1,962. In U24, they are now decreasing the DoT damage by 63% to bring the total damage to 713. So, in U22 they think the skills is underperforming and UP the total damage, now they think it is too much so they dial back to be worse than in U22 when they thought it was underperforming. This is just one example that shows they are NOT doing any kind of balancing whatsoever. This whole game for this team is what they FEEL like or think would be COOL from patch to patch.

    And every class having a CC. And a source of major sorcery/brutality. And a purge....

    Seriously, the 3 month cycle nerf madness is starting to get strange feedback loops. For example, draining shot got deemed a "utility" skill and had its range, damage and heal nerfed last patch. Now it loses the CC that justified the previous nerfs.

    The list is sort of endless. The new nerfs undo the sense of the previous nerfs, and when you add up the cumulative nerfs the skills become useless. I'm not sure ZOS even keeps track of it; they just spasmodically react with nerfs to whatever skill is triggering any random poster.
